Transaction 3965958299cdcf91777c350f55bb3f0d6ecfc009375ec9bb1f40bbc6e84353cc
2 Input
1 Outputs
- 3965958299cdcf91777c350f55bb3f0d6ecfc009375ec9bb1f40bbc6e84353cc:0
value 1327647
address bc1qseghvwyj6mz2p4mrmgp4e030844kctdymwxhpx